Key Factors for Choosing Instant CNC Quote Platforms

Several critical factors determine whether an online CNC machining platform fits your projects. Quote speed remains paramount, with leading platforms now delivering estimates in under an hour. Speed alone does not guarantee value, because material availability, tolerance capabilities, and DFM depth separate professional-grade services from basic job shops. U.S. manufacturing percentage significantly impacts IP security and supply chain reliability, particularly for sensitive projects requiring ITAR compliance or rapid turnaround.

Pricing transparency, minimum volume requirements, and customer reviews provide insight into platform reliability and long-term fit. A significant number of fabrication quotes now run through online platforms, so platform selection directly affects your competitive position.

DFM Red Flags That Increase Costs

Beyond quote speed and pricing, the quality of a platform’s DFM feedback directly affects your total project cost. Common design pitfalls can dramatically increase manufacturing costs and lead times. Specifying tight tolerances on non-critical features in CNC machining increases machine time and costs, while up to 80% of manufacturing cost is locked in during the design phase. 2. XometryXometry launched version 3.0 of its Instant Quoting Engine on June 27, 2018. Xometry offers instant single quotes for CNC machining RFQs from over 5,000 vetted suppliers in its global manufacturing partner network spanning 49 US states and 50+ countries. This model provides broad capacity and fast quotes, although quality consistency can vary across their supplier network.

3. Protolabs – Protolabs excels at extremely fast-turnaround prototypes. Protolabs often delivers parts in days via systems optimized for speed and standardized designs, though limited by looser tolerances and material availability. The platform works best for rapid concept validation rather than production-ready parts.

4. FictivFictiv’s cloud-connected manufacturing marketplace provides project visibility tools and access to a broad range of materials, but often involves inconsistent quality control and hidden costs like import duties from overseas suppliers. Fictiv offers lead times as fast as 1 day.

5. eMachineShop – eMachineShop provides free CAD tools and competitive pricing for simple parts. The platform has limited advanced DFM capabilities and struggles with complex geometries. It works best for straightforward machining projects with standard tolerances.

6. Jiga – Jiga focuses on connecting buyers with verified suppliers globally and offers transparency in supplier selection. Customers often need to manage projects more actively, because coordination and oversight remain in the buyer’s hands.

7. Xmake – Xmake is an emerging platform with competitive pricing and solid turnaround times. The company continues to build its reputation and supplier network, so it trails more established players in proven track record.

8. RapidDirect – RapidDirect enables scalability from rapid prototyping to mass production with similarly aggressive lead times for rush orders. Chinese CNC manufacturers like RapidDirect offer 30-50% cost savings compared to local manufacturers, but introduce IP security concerns and longer total lead times when shipping is included.

US vs. Global Risks and When Integrated Manufacturing Wins

The choice between U.S.-based and international platforms involves critical trade-offs beyond cost. The cost advantage mentioned earlier, typically 30-50% lower than U.S. manufacturers, comes with significant trade-offs beyond price, including risks around IP security, quality consistency, and supply chain disruptions. Local US CNC machining companies are superior for ITAR/defense projects and parts needed within 48 hours due to proximity enabling next-day rush orders.

Marketplace platforms often fail when projects require complex integration of machining, finishing, and assembly because they must coordinate multiple vendors who may use incompatible processes or quality standards. Common Pitfalls and Real-User Warnings

Industry forums reveal recurring issues with online CNC platforms. Hidden fees for rush orders, poor DFM feedback that leads to costly rework, and drop-shipping arrangements that obscure actual manufacturing locations all create project delays. Common pitfalls include underestimating lead times, forgetting to specify certifications, and failing to compare quotes on a like-for-like basis. Quality control problems often appear when platforms lack direct manufacturing oversight, particularly with overseas suppliers.
